Understanding ADAS Calibration in your Car
ADAS calibration refers to the process of adjusting vehicle systems to ensure they operate within designated parameters. Today’s vehicles come equipped with advanced technology such as sensors, cameras, and computerized control units, all of which must be calibrated accurately. This process ensures that the vehicle can respond appropriately to various environments, ensuring safety and efficiency.
For instance, calibration is crucial for systems like adaptive cruise control, lane-keeping assistance, and automatic emergency braking. If these systems are not calibrated correctly, the vehicle may not respond as intended. An improperly calibrated sensor could lead to a false reading, which can jeopardize the safety of the driver and passengers, as well as others on the road.

The Role of Car Calibration in Safety
Safety is a paramount concern when it comes to vehicle operation, making calibration a critical process. Many advanced driver-assistance systems (ADAS) rely on calibrated sensors to enhance vehicle safety. For example, these systems can help prevent collisions by monitoring the environment around the vehicle.
According to the National Highway Traffic Safety Administration (NHTSA), rear-end collisions account for about 29% of all crashes. Many newer vehicles come equipped with features designed to prevent such accidents. However, if the sensors that power these systems are misaligned or improperly calibrated, they may fail to detect obstacles, increasing the likelihood of a crash.
By ensuring that your vehicle undergoes proper calibration, you significantly reduce the risk of accidents. Regular checks and calibrations can lead to improved vehicle safety, providing peace of mind to drivers and passengers alike.

How to Ensure Proper Calibration
To ensure your vehicle remains properly calibrated, follow these recommendations:
Routine Inspections: Schedule regular inspections with a certified mechanic who can check all calibrated systems on your vehicle. Look for professionals who specialize in modern vehicle calibration.
Use Manufacturer Guidelines: Make sure to adhere to the calibration recommendations set forth by your vehicle's manufacturer. They provide specific guidelines and intervals for calibration based on the model.
Software Updates: With the rise of technology in vehicles, manufacturers frequently issue software updates to correct calibration issues. Ensure your vehicle's software is up to date.
Seek Professional Help: If your vehicle has experienced significant changes, such as an accident or the installation of new components, seek professional help immediately to recalibrate the systems involved.
By following these simple steps, you can ensure that your vehicle remains safe, efficient, and high-performing.

Maintaining Vehicle Longevity
Proper calibration not only impacts performance but also extends the longevity of your vehicle. Components that are well-calibrated experience less wear over time, leading to a reduction in repairs and extending the life of the vehicle.
For example, a camera that is properly calibrated will use less computing power to interpret the image its seeing. One major failure point for cameras is excessive heat generation over time. If the camera is properly calibrated, it has to use less computing power and thus creates less heat. Lower overall heat means a longer service life of that camera.
By ensuring your vehicle is well-calibrated, you are making a wise investment in its longevity and reliability. This can save you a substantial amount in maintenance and replacement costs down the line.
